Toxoplasma Serology


General
  Clinical Use: Diagnostic testing for Toxoplasma gondii infection (toxoplasmosis). Toxoplasma IgG is performed on all requests. Toxoplasma IgM is performed if specifically requested, if clinical history indicates acute infection, or if Toxoplasma IgG is detected. If Toxoplasma IgM is detected by the screening assay, a supplementary assay is performed to confirm detection. Specimens may be referred to Pathology West, NSW, for Toxoplasma IgG avidity testing if required.
